Reflection for Today

Today's Catholic verse of the day is Psalms 30:3: “Bow down thy ear to me: make haste to deliver me. Be thou unto me a God, a protector, and a house of refuge, to save me.”

Scripture rarely flatters us. It loves us enough to tell the truth, and then it stays with us while we learn to live that truth. The Psalms have given voice to every mood of the believer: praise, tears, trust, and longing. What Israel prayed, the Church still sings.

Today's invitation under the theme of Salvation is simple and serious. If the verse convicts you, do not panic. Take it to Confession when you can, or begin with an honest Act of Contrition tonight.
